Family and friends mourn the loss of their loved ones at the scene of a car accident near the intersection of E Main St and N Sprinkle Rd in Kalamazoo, Mich. on Saturday, September 2, 2017. The car was said to be going approximately 100 mph before it crashed into a tree, taking the lives of all five teenagers in the vehicle. (Kaytie Boomer | MLive.com)

Cena the war dog lies in his wagon as people hold American flags in his honor behind him at the Mart Dock before his last ride on Wednesday, July 26, 2017 in Muskegon, Mich. He was a bomb sniffing dog in many wars and he got an inoperable bone cancer after all of his service, so he was laid to rest. (Kaytie Boomer | MLive.com)

Family, friends and staff surround Vietnam veteran Wayne Whisler, 66, to hold hands and pray together at the Hillcrest Nursing Center on Friday, July 28, 2017 in North Muskegon, Mich. Whisler had only a few days left to live and his last wish was to see a group of motorcyclists and their bikes. Over 700 motorcyclists showed up to honor him when he only wished for a small group to arrive. (Kaytie Boomer | MLive.com)

The funeral procession for Norton Shores police officer Jonathan Ginka along Ruddiman Drive on Tuesday, May 16, 2017 in North Muskegon, Mich. Ginka was killed after his police cruiser struck a tree in the early morning hours of May 10 along Henry Street between Ross and Forest Park Roads in Norton Shores, Mich. (Kaytie Boomer | MLive.com)
